Inaugurated on September the 14th 2012, Stendhal Museum is a project which goes beyond the simple restoration of an heritage of furniture. Its mission is to make the public sensitive to the literary work of Stendhal.

This museum, belonging to the Municipal library of Grenoble, gathers :
> Gagnon's apartment, a museographic space and a place of memory
> Stendhal's natal apartment, the living place dedicated to contemporary literature
> Study and Information Library's collections
> A historic itinerary in the ancient centre

GAGNON'S APARTMENT

Docteur Gagnon's apartment, Stendhal's grandfather, located in the ancient center of the city, is the founding element of Stendhal museum. It was there that Stendhal was used to findind shelter from his aunt Séraphie and from his father, Chérubin Beyle, and that he grew up next to his grandfather.

THE NATAL APARTMENT

Painstakingly depicted by Stendhal himself in Vie de Henry Brulard, this apartment, typical of the type of accomodation which was that of the XVIIIth century bourgeois of Grenoble, used to belong to Stendhal's father's family since several generations. To the young Henri, this place was the synonym of happiness until his mother Henriette passed away, in 1790 : he was only 7 at that time.
Then, it became mostly a place of studies, where the young Henri suffered from the authority of his preceptor, the dull and stern abbot Raillane. It was in the drawing-room which overlooked the rue des Vieux-Jésuites that Stendhal, as a teenager, wrote Selmours, his first literary essay.

THE MUNICIPAL LIBRARY'S COLLECTION "MUSEE STENDHAL"

Founded in 1861 and gradually enriched, the Stendhal fund, considered as the most important of the world, consists in three parts:
> 1000 printed copied, all in their original editions, numerous foreign edition as well as studies, thesis and bibliographies on the writer
> 1 151 iconographic pieces of work
> 40 000 manuscript pages (of Lamiel, Souvenirs d'égotisme, Nouvelles etc, ...).

The STENDHALIAN ITINERARIES

Organised by the Office of Tourism, the historical Stendhal itinerary offers the visitors to discover houses or places which are intimately linked to Stendhal's life, signposted by patrimonial plates.
